Timezone in Zyogouiné
Zyogouiné operates under the timezone Africa/Abidjan, which has a UTC offset of zero hours. This means that Zyogouiné does not observe daylight saving time, maintaining a consistent standard time throughout the year. As a result, there are no seasonal changes to the clock, making it straightforward for scheduling and planning.
When comparing the time difference with the United States, Zyogouiné is typically five to six hours ahead of Eastern Standard Time, depending on the time of year, and eight to nine hours ahead of Pacific Standard Time.
